AI Technical Summary
Children and adults differ significantly in body shape and skin sensitivity, and traditional mechanical abdominal massage devices may cause food reflux or organ compression damage.
An intelligent abdominal massage device was designed, which uses positioning components and distance adjustment mechanism. The fit between the massage head and the abdomen is adjusted by positioning blocks and airbags. Combined with pressure sensors and heating elements, it achieves a gentle massage effect and can be massaged counterclockwise or clockwise to regulate intestinal peristalsis.
It avoids continuous pressure injury to children's abdomen, provides a personalized massage experience, improves comfort and safety, and adapts to different intestinal function needs.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of abdominal massage technology, specifically to an intelligent auxiliary abdominal massage device for pediatric treatment. Background Technology
[0002] Children's digestive systems are not fully developed, making them prone to digestive issues such as n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, constipation, and diarrhea. Abdominal massage is crucial for children's daily health care. In nature, it is a green and non-toxic physical therapy. Its therapeutic and health-preserving functions are widely recognized, hence its popularity in the modern healthcare field. Traditional massage is mostly performed by therapists using their hands, which has drawbacks such as high labor intensity, high labor costs, inconsistent skill levels, and the inability of patients to operate the massage themselves. Therefore, it has spurred the development and application of electric massage devices.
[0003] A search revealed patent application number (202110401234.7), which discloses "A Pediatric Abdominal Digestion Aid Massage Device." The device includes a support frame. An electric telescopic rod is fixedly mounted at the top center of the support frame, and a slide rail is fixedly connected to the top of the electric telescopic rod. A connecting plate is fixedly connected to the left end of the slide rail, and a motor is fixedly mounted at the bottom end of the connecting plate. A rotating shaft is mounted at the top of the motor, and a connecting rod A is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the rotating shaft. A connecting rod B is rotatably connected to the top of the connecting rod A. A slider is rotatably connected to the top of the connecting rod B, and the top of the slider is slidably connected to the bottom end of the slide rail. Limiting grooves A are fixedly connected to both the left and right sides of the bottom end of the slider, and limiting blocks A are slidably connected between the limiting grooves A. This invention has a simple structure and novel design, effectively fixing the device and massage bed, greatly improving the device's practicality. Furthermore, the entire massage process does not require manual labor, significantly saving manpower.
[0004] However, the above-mentioned device has the following problems: children are different from adults, with significant differences in body shape and skin sensitivity. Continuous mechanical pressure may cause food reflux or compressive damage to organs in children. Therefore, we propose an intelligent abdominal massage device for pediatric treatment to solve the above problems.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The purpose of this invention is to provide an intelligent abdominal massage for pediatric treatment, in order to solve the problem mentioned in the background art that children are different from adults, with significant differences in body shape and skin sensitivity, and that continuous mechanical pressure may cause food reflux or compressive damage to organs in children.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ides the following technical solution: an intelligent abdominal massager for pediatric treatment, comprising a massage mechanism housed inside a housing, the massage mechanism including a base, a first servo motor, a rotating head base, and massage heads. The base is housed inside the housing, and the first servo motor is installed inside the base. The output end of the first servo motor is fixedly connected to the rotating head base. Multiple sets of massage heads are fixedly connected to the outer surface of the rotating head base. Two sets of positioning components are provided on both sides of the bottom of the housing, and two sets of fixing straps are connected to the outer side of the housing. A distance adjustment mechanism is provided on the top of the massage mechanism. A fixing frame is fixedly installed inside the outer shell. Several sets of support frames are fixedly connected to the upper end of the fixing frame. A first fixing plate and a second fixing plate are respectively connected to the bottom of the support frame. The positioning component includes a second servo motor, a drive wheel, a timing belt, a rotating shaft, a driven wheel, a connecting plate, a connecting rod, and a positioning block. The positioning block has auxiliary components inside.
[0007] Preferably, a second servo motor is fixedly installed inside the first fixed plate. The output end of the second servo motor is fixedly connected to a drive wheel. A synchronous belt is movably connected to the outer side of the drive wheel. Two pairs of fixed blocks are symmetrically installed at the bottom of the fixed frame. A rotating shaft is rotatably connected inside the two sets of fixed blocks. A driven wheel is fixedly connected to the outer side of the rotating shaft. The other end of the synchronous belt is sleeved on the surface of the driven wheel. A connecting plate is fixedly connected to the outer side of the rotating shaft. A connecting rod is fixedly connected to the other end of the connecting plate. A positioning block is provided on the outer side of the connecting rod. The bottom of the positioning block is arc-shaped.
[0008] Preferably, the upper end of the massage mechanism is provided with a distance adjustment mechanism, which includes a micro air pump, a three-way valve, a connecting pipe and an airbag. The micro air pump is fixedly installed inside the second fixing plate. The output end of the micro air pump is fixedly connected to the three-way valve. The other two ends of the three-way valve are fixedly connected to the connecting pipe. The interior of the second fixing plate has two sets of fixing holes. The bottom of the two sets of fixing holes is respectively connected to an airbag. The bottom of the airbag is fixedly connected to a base.
[0009] Preferably, the auxiliary components include a pressure sensor and a heating element. The pressure sensor is installed at the center of the positioning block, and the output end of the pressure sensor is located on the outer surface of the positioning block. Two sets of heating elements are symmetrically installed inside the positioning block with the pressure sensor as the center.
[0010] Preferably, a battery is installed inside the first fixing plate, and a PLC controller is installed at the center of the first fixing plate. The battery is located outside the PLC controller, and the PLC controller is connected to the base, the second servo motor, the micro air pump, the pressure sensor, and the heating element via wires.
[0011] Preferably, a first elastic protective cloth is fixedly connected to the top edge of the positioning block, the other end of the first elastic protective cloth is fixedly connected to the bottom of the outer shell, a second elastic protective cloth is fixedly connected to the inner side of the positioning block, and the other end of the second elastic protective cloth is fixedly connected to the bottom edge of the base.
[0012] Preferably, the distance adjustment mechanism further includes a distance detection component, which consists of a counting code disk and a position detection sensor. The counting code disk is fixedly connected to the front side of the base, and the position detection sensor is fixedly installed at the bottom of the support frame. The output end of the position detection sensor faces the counting code disk.
[0013] Preferably, the positioning block is rotatably connected to the outer surface of the connecting rod.
[0014]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are: This invention features a rationally designed structure. The positioning block at the positioning component can fit snugly against the abdomen, while simultaneously calibrating the position of the massage head relative to the user's abdomen. This allows for heat therapy and massage of different body parts, avoiding continuous pressure on the child's abdomen. The massage mechanism effectively regulates intestinal peristalsis, performing counterclockwise or clockwise massage. Counterclockwise massage slows down intestinal peristalsis and is suitable for cases of overactive intestines, while clockwise massage promotes intestinal peristalsis and is suitable for cases of insufficient intestinal peristalsis.
[0015] This invention features a high degree of intelligence. The pressure sensor can monitor pressure, and the massage height can be quickly adjusted via the distance adjustment mechanism. It is easy to use, and the massage device has a reasonable structure, making it convenient for later maintenance. Attached Figure Description

[0020] Please see Figure 1-7This invention provides an embodiment of an intelligent abdominal massager for pediatric treatment, comprising a massage mechanism 2 housed inside a housing 1. A control button is installed at the front end of the housing 1, and a connection hole and a charging hole are installed at the rear end. The massage mechanism 2 includes a base 201, a first servo motor 202, a rotating head base 203, and massage heads 204. The base 201 is housed inside the housing 1, and the first servo motor 202 is installed inside the base 201. The output end of the first servo motor 202 is fixedly connected to the rotating head base 203. Multiple sets of massage heads 204 with different shapes are fixedly connected to the outer surface of the rotating head base 203. Two sets of positioning components 3 are provided on both sides of the bottom of the housing 1, simulating hands holding the sides of the abdomen to support the housing 1. To prevent the massage mechanism 2 at the bottom of the outer shell 1 from directly contacting the user's abdomen under the fixation of the fixing strap 4, which could cause pressure and discomfort to users with sensitive skin, two sets of fixing straps 4 are connected to the outside of the outer shell 1. A distance adjustment mechanism 5 is provided on the top of the massage mechanism 2. A fixing frame 101 is fixedly installed inside the outer shell 1. Several sets of support frames 102 are fixedly connected to the upper end of the fixing frame 101. The bottom of the support frame 102 is respectively connected to the first fixing plate 103 and the second fixing plate 104. The positioning component 3 includes a second servo motor 301, a drive wheel 302, a synchronous belt 303, a rotating shaft 305, a driven wheel 306, a connecting plate 307, a connecting rod 308 and a positioning block 309. An auxiliary component 6 is provided inside the positioning block 309. This device, through the setting of positioning component 3 and distance adjustment mechanism 5, solves the problem that children are different from adults, with significant differences in body shape and skin sensitivity, and that continuous mechanical pressure can cause food reflux or compressive damage to organs.
[0021] Furthermore, a second servo motor 301 is fixedly installed inside the first fixed plate 103. A drive wheel 302 is fixedly connected to the output end of the second servo motor 301. A synchronous belt 303 is movably connected to the outer side of the drive wheel 302. Two pairs of fixed blocks 304 are symmetrically installed at the bottom of the fixed frame 101. A rotating shaft 305 is rotatably connected inside the two sets of fixed blocks 304. A driven wheel 306 is fixedly connected to the outer side of the rotating shaft 305. The other end of the synchronous belt 303 is sleeved on the surface of the driven wheel 306. The outer side of the rotating shaft 305... A connecting plate 307 is fixedly connected, and a connecting rod 308 is fixedly connected to the other end of the connecting plate 307. A positioning block 309 is provided on the outer side of the connecting rod 308. Two sets of connecting plates 307 are connected to both ends of the connecting rod 308 respectively. One set of connecting plates 307 is fixedly connected to a rotating shaft 305, and the other set of connecting plates 307 is rotatably connected to another set of rotating shafts 305. The other positioning component 3 is similar. The bottom of the positioning block 309 is arc-shaped and made of silicone to improve the anti-slip effect and prevent displacement, thereby avoiding scratches. Figure 6As shown, this structure is used to place the outer shell 1 on the user's abdomen. According to the patient's body shape and needs, the second servo motor 301 is activated to drive the drive wheel 302 to rotate. The driven wheel 306 and the rotating shaft 305 are driven to rotate through the synchronous belt 303. The connecting plate 307 and the connecting rod 308 drive the positioning block 309 to rotate, so that the positioning block 309 fits against both sides of the user's abdomen. The two sets of positioning blocks 309 support the outer shell 1, preventing the massage head 204 from directly contacting the patient's abdomen and causing pressure on the user's abdomen.
[0022] Furthermore, the upper end of the massage mechanism 2 is provided with a distance adjustment mechanism 5, which includes a micro air pump 501, a three-way valve 502, a connecting pipe 503, and an airbag 505. The micro air pump 501 is fixedly installed inside the second fixing plate 104. The output end of the micro air pump 501 is fixedly connected to the three-way valve 502, and the other two ends of the three-way valve 502 are fixedly connected to the connecting pipe 503. Two sets of fixing holes 504 are opened inside the second fixing plate 104, and the bottoms of the two sets of fixing holes 504 are respectively connected to airbags 505. The bottom of the airbags 505 is fixedly connected to a base 201. Figure 5 As shown, the structure is used for support by the positioning component 3. At this time, the massage head 204 is kept at a certain distance from the user's abdomen. According to the patient's tolerance, the micro air pump 501 is activated. The gas enters the airbag 505 through the fixing hole 504 through the three-way valve 502 and the connecting pipe 503, inflating the airbag 505, thereby moving the base 201 to the appropriate position.
[0023] Furthermore, the auxiliary component 6 includes a pressure sensor 601 and a heating element 602. The pressure sensor 601 is installed at the center of the positioning block 309, and the output end of the pressure sensor 601 is located on the outer surface of the positioning block 309. Two sets of heating elements 602 are symmetrically installed inside the positioning block 309 with the pressure sensor 601 as the center. Figure 7 As shown, when the positioning block 309 is attached to the patient's abdomen, the internal pressure sensor 601 detects the pressure to avoid excessive pressure under the fixation of the fixing strap 4, which could cause discomfort to the user. The heating pads 602 on both sides generate heat when attached to provide heat to the user's abdomen, thereby improving the massage effect.
[0024] Furthermore, a battery 603 is installed inside the first fixing plate 103, and a PLC controller 604 is installed at the center of the first fixing plate 103. The battery 603 is located outside the PLC controller 604. The PLC controller 604 is connected to the base 201, the second servo motor 301, the micro air pump 501, the pressure sensor 601, and the heating element 602 via wires. Figure 7As shown, the structure is used to power the internal electronic components via the battery 603, while the PLC controller 604 controls the start and stop of the internal base 201, the second servo motor 301, the micro air pump 501, the pressure sensor 601, and the heating element 602.
[0025] Furthermore, a first elastic protective cloth 7 is fixedly connected to the top edge of the positioning block 309, and the other end of the first elastic protective cloth 7 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the outer casing 1. A second elastic protective cloth 8 is fixedly connected to the inner side of the positioning block 309, and the other end of the second elastic protective cloth 8 is fixedly connected to the bottom edge of the base 201. Figure 2 As shown, this structure is used to stretch the first elastic protective cloth 7 and the second elastic protective cloth 8 when the positioning block 309 rotates, so as to avoid gaps between the positioning block 309 and the outer shell 1 and the base 201, thus playing a role in dust prevention and protection.
[0026] Furthermore, the distance adjustment mechanism 5 also includes a distance detection component, which consists of a counting disk 506 and a position detection sensor 507. The counting disk 506 is fixedly connected to the front side of the base 201, and the position detection sensor 507 is fixedly installed at the bottom of the support frame 102. The output end of the position detection sensor 507 faces the counting disk 506. Figure 5 As shown, this structure is used to detect or record the position of the counting code disk 506 through several through holes. The position detection sensor 507 is a photoelectric sensor. The through holes at different positions correspond to the position detection sensor 507, which is used to detect or record the position of the counting code disk 506, thereby determining the height position of the base 201. The airbag 505 extends and retracts the base 201, so that the counting code disk 506 moves with the base 201 to change its position, thereby realizing the output of the height position of the base 201.
[0027] Furthermore, the positioning block 309 is rotatably connected to the outer surface of the connecting rod 308. For example... Figure 7 As shown, this structure is rotatably connected to the outside of the connecting rod 308 via the positioning block 309. When the positioning block 309 contacts the user's body surface, it can rotate freely, fit against the body surface to increase the contact area, and improve the stability of the device.
[0028] Working principle: When using, such as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the outer shell 1 is placed on the user's abdomen, and two sets of fixing straps 4 are wrapped around the user's body to simply secure the outer shell 1, as shown. Figure 2 , Figure 6 and Figure 7As shown, based on the patient's body shape and needs, the second servo motor 301 is activated to drive the active wheel 302 to rotate. This, in turn, drives the driven wheel 306 and the rotating shaft 305 to rotate via the synchronous belt 303. This causes the connecting plate 307 and connecting rod 308 to rotate the positioning block 309, placing it against both sides of the user's abdomen. The two sets of positioning blocks 309 support the outer shell 1, preventing the massage head 204 from directly contacting the patient's abdomen and causing pressure. When the positioning blocks 309 rotate, they stretch the first elastic protective cloth 7 and the second elastic protective cloth 8. When the positioning blocks 309 are against the patient's abdomen, the internal pressure sensor 601 detects the pressure to prevent excessive pressure from the fixing straps 4, which could cause discomfort. The heating pads 602 on both sides generate heat during contact, providing a warm compress to the user's abdomen and improving the massage effect. Figure 5 As shown, the massage head 204 maintains a certain distance from the user's abdomen. Based on the patient's tolerance, the micro air pump 501 is activated. Gas enters the airbag 505 through the fixing hole 504 via the three-way valve 502 and connecting pipe 503, inflating the airbag 505 and thus moving the base 201 to a suitable position. The position detection sensor 507 detects and records the position of the counting bar 506 to determine the height position of the base 201. Then, the first servo motor 202 is activated to drive the rotating head base 203 to rotate, so that the massage head 204 on the surface of the rotating head base 203 massages the user's abdomen counterclockwise or clockwise. Counterclockwise massage is used to slow down intestinal peristalsis and is suitable for cases of overactive intestines, while clockwise massage is used to promote intestinal peristalsis and is suitable for cases of insufficient intestinal peristalsis. The above is the complete working principle of the present invention.
